SUMMARY South Africa started this competition with an impressive 97-0 win over the USA and finished top of their pool unbeaten with wins over (31-24) and France (2-19). They scored 154 points and 22 tries in their three pool games, conceding 43 points. Their semi-final opponents, Wales, stole victory from the Junior Springboks with a last minute try by Ashley Evans to win 1-17, to send South Africa into the third place playoff for the fourth time in this competition. New Zealand started this year s competition as they have so many others, handing out a 59- beating to Fiji. Next came a close 14- victory against Australia, before beating Ireland 31-2 in their final game in the pool stages, thereby ensuring their place in the semi-final top of their group. A surprising 33-21 loss to in the semi-finals set New Zealand up for a third place play-off match against last year s champions South Africa.
